Are you looking for a hands-on internship that puts you at the heart of real-world engineering challenges? Join us as a Civil or Environmental Engineering Intern in Minneapolis, MN for Summer 2026 and gain experience working on projects in solid waste management. From observing landfill construction to assisting with regulatory efforts, you’ll collaborate with experienced professionals and contribute directly to provide a positive environmental impact. This is your opportunity to build skills, make connections, and see your work come to life!
Primary Responsibilities:
- Conduct landfill construction observation
- Participate in waste characterization studies
- Assist with the design of landfills, transfer stations, and recycling facilities
- Assist with data analysis and regulatory reporting
- Gain exposure to solid waste planning, including waste diversion and recycling
- Support other project work as assigned
Required Qualifications:
- Pursuing a Bachelor's Degree in Civil or Environmental Engineering or a related field from an ABET-accredited program
Preferred Qualifications:
- GPA of 3.0 or greater
- Previous engineering experience through an internship or co-op
